Introduction to Cory in the House
“Cory in the House” premiered in 2007 and ran for two seasons, ending in 2008. The show revolves around Cory Baxter, played by Kyle Massey, as he navigates life in the White House, encountering various comedic situations and learning valuable lessons. The series aimed to appeal to a similar audience as “That’s So Raven,” focusing on teenage life, friendship, and the challenges of growing up in an unusual environment. Despite its premise and potential, “Cory in the House” received mixed reviews, with some critics feeling that it lacked the magic of its predecessor.
The Role of Family in Cory in the House
The family dynamic plays a significant role in both “That’s So Raven” and “Cory in the House.” In “That’s So Raven,” the Baxter family, including parents Victor and Tanya and their children Raven and Cory, are central to the show’s humor and heart. However, in transitioning to “Cory in the House,” the family setup underwent significant changes. Cory’s father, Victor, played by Rondell Sheridan, moved to Washington, D.C. with Cory, while Raven, the main character of the original series, was pursuing her own life. This setup inherently meant that some characters from the original series would not be as prominent or even appear in the spin-off.
